What you will be doing




Accept incoming client troubleshooting calls and make outbound calls in response to email requests Engage with clients via email, providing clear and prompt communication Leverage your Windows proficiency, network skills and knowledge of inter-connectivity with servers and printers to prepare and set up laptops and desktops Conduct basic client account administration in Office 365 and Active Directory Track scheduled work, proactively communicating changes to all stakeholders, and promptly updating both the schedule and clients as needed Log detailed case notes in Ntiva's ticketing system and other documentation platforms, ensuring clear and accurate records Assess the need for documentation updates and inform management of any necessary changes Maintain a positive and client-centric focus throughout all interactions, fostering trust and building strong client relationships Maintain meticulous attention to detail to uphold accuracy and efficiency standards




You'll be successful in this role if you have experience in/with




At least 1 year of professional work experience in the IT industry Proficiency with troubleshooting problems with, but not limited to, the following technical subjects: + - VPN - Internet connectivity losses
- Remote desktop
- Microsoft Office software
- Peripherals, including printers, scanners, and monitors
Familiarity with administration of Office 365 and Exchange Online Proficiency in navigation and administration of Active Directory Working knowledge of Windows file shares (SMB/CIFS) Strong communication and writing skills Ability to review, understand, and implement SOPs and other written training
